A typed letter from Fred Mohr and John Warfield of the University of Oregon Upward Bound program to UO President Charles Johnson suggesting a lower number of credit hours for disadvantaged Upward Bound students to qualify for "normal progress toward the degree" to the Selective Services. Document from the University of Oregon Office of the President.
